"I have Ki-Washer up and running but I don't see this feature - or at least it is not removing the *.dat file. Windows says that another program is writing to it which I suspect is Explorer. Any ideas?"

The default value of the index.dat file when it has zero info in it is 32K so that it gets bigger than that as you visit more and more sites.

Just after you boot up, and before you do any surfing, check the index.dat file in temporary internet files for your user name if you are using XP. If it is only 32K then Ki-Washer is working. ( In a couple of temp int files sub-folders I have noticed that some index.dat files are only 16K. I have yet to find out why that is. )

After you visit a bunch of sites the index.dat file for temporary internet files will grow beyond 32K. Be aware that there are other index.dat files on your computer and you should concern yourself only with those that occupy temporary internet files and the sub-folders thereof. If you think that the index.dat files are not being wiped out then you can do a search for Index Dat Viewer. It's a small program that will let you see what's in the file but my knowledge of Ki-Washer tells me that yours is working as advertised.
